This worked for me. I have the domain names registered in godaddy. I had to go into godaddy "DNS Zone File" and "point" the domain names to my external IP address. Don't use "settings" "forwarding"
NameVirtualHost *:80 # ********************Begin First Web Page *********************************** <VirtualHost *:80> DocumentRoot "C:/Server/Apache2.2/www/Site1/htdocs" Servername Site1.com ServerAlias www.site1.com ErrorLog "logs/site1.localhost-error.log" CustomLog "logs/site1.localhost-access.log" common <Directory /> Options FollowSymLinks AllowOverride None Order deny,allow Deny from all </Directory> # <Directory "C:/Server/Apache2.2/www/site1/htdocs"> Options Indexes FollowSymLinks AllowOverride None Order allow,deny Allow from all </Directory> </VirtualHost> # ******************End First Web Page *********************************** # # # # #****************Begin Second Web Page **************************** <VirtualHost *:80> DocumentRoot "C:/Server/Apache2.2/www/Site2/htdocs" ServerName site2.us ServerAlias www.site2.us ErrorLog "logs/site2.localhost-error.log" CustomLog "logs/site2.localhost-access.log" common # <Directory /> Options FollowSymLinks AllowOverride None Order deny,allow Deny from all </Directory> # <Directory "C:/Server/Apache2.2/www/site2/htdocs"> Options Indexes FollowSymLinks AllowOverride None Order allow,deny Allow from all </Directory> </VirtualHost> # ********************End Second Web Page ********************************** # On Saturday, April 19, 2014 6:51 AM, Eric Covener <cove...@gmail.com> wrote: On Sat, Apr 19, 2014 at 9:32 AM, Michael Peters <michael.pet...@lazarusalliance.com> wrote: > IS it ok to have directory statements like this and virtualhost together? > > <Directory "/www/html/site_1"> > Options Indexes FollowSymLinks > AllowOverride None > Order allow,deny > Allow from all > </Directory> Yes.
